The dive started grim because of very poor visibility and no sight of mantas for the first 10 mins. Then we hit the cleaning station and all hell broke loose. I checked the time stamp on the first and last manta shot and they were 1 hour apart. Needless to say, we overstayed during this dive.

ok lah, maybe some mantas came back more than once so perhaps it was lesser than 40. feeling better?

On the same day, we saw another group of smaller mantas (after sighting 2 whalesharks... )



It is no wonder I vow to go back Maldives again after that day

You serious bo?...

Anyway, the sighting was at Rangali Kandu-Madiravu at South Ari Atoll in Feb-05 (2 months after the Tsunami). We were on a very new boat call Handhu Falhi (means half moon) by Radiant Heat Travels. Website is : http://www.radheattravel.com/safari_main.html

I have heard of other boat operators whom guarantee Whaleshark and Manta sightings! You like?
